What does a comprehensive vehicle inspection include?

The inspection will include everything the manufacturer specifies and is required for the logbook service. Everything below, and much much more!

  • 1. Test drive

    The engine, drivetrain, brakes and suspension in your vehicle will be tested to ensure that they are up to standard.

  • 2. Operational check

    The standard components of your vehicle such as seat belts, lights, wipers including washers and arm mechanism, horn will be inspected. The air/cabin filters and housing will also be checked.

  • 3. Digital battery check

    Your battery will be tested and printed results will be provided.

  • 4. Inspection of underbody

    A visual inspection will be conducted for leaks from your engine, exhaust system, fuel line and gearbox.

  • 5. Tyre pressure and tread wear check

    The condition, pressure and tread wear of your tyres (including the spare) will be inspected to ensure that it is up to the legal standard.

  • 6. Brake wear recommendation

    A precise measurement can be provided to you. This will also include a fluid condition check.

  • 7. Suspension system check

    Joints and bearings in your vehicle will be checked for any leaks.

  • 8. Final assessment of vehicle

    The wheels are cross checked and a final road test is performed to ensure quality of the service and operations performed.

Routine car maintenance is typically recommended for every six months or 10,000km driven, whichever comes first. Choose from our logbook or basic servicing options.

Have a newer car? You’ll want to maintain your logbook servicing. Not only does it help to ensure your car remains in good condition, a stamped logbook can increase resale value if you decide to sell your car down the track. The logbook contains service lists set out by the manufacturer for your specific vehicle model and is signed by your mechanic when the service is complete.

Basic servicing is a budget-friendly option for older cars that still covers all the important stuff.
